A helical spring of stiffness k is cut into two halves and a mass m is connected to the two halves as shown below Fig. 1-(a). The natural time period of this system is found to be 0.5 s. If an identical spring is cut so that one part is one-fourth and the other part three-fourths of the original length, and the mass m is connected to the two parts as shown in below Fig. 1-(b), what would be the natural period of the system?
